Downton Abbey season 4 press event held before new series launch in September [NEW CAST PHOTOS, PREVIEW VIDEO]

ITV

The first cast photos of British drama "Downton Abbey" season 4 has been revealed.

Meanwhile, a press event for the series 4 launch was held this week at the Mayfair Hotel in London for a sneak peak to one of the most successful shows in recent years.

However, not much of the three-part can be revealed yet, as journalists signed embargo forms to not release or tweet about it until Sept.12, according to the Telegraph.

ITV's British period drama series is set in the Yorkshire country estate of Downton Abbey, following the lives of the aristocratic Crawley family and their servants in the post-Edwardian era.

The series has been wildly popular since it premiered on ITV in UK in September 2010. The show is just as popular in the US, which premiered in January 2011 on PBS. It is the most watched series on both ITV and PBS.

Season 4 of the series is set to premiere in the UK next month, but the exact date has not been specified. Fans across the pond will have to wait until Jan. 5, 2014, for the upcoming season on PBS Masterpiece.

New cast members joining the show are Paul Giamatti, Tom Cullen, Nigel Harman, Dame Harriet Walter, Joanna David, Julian Ovenden, Dame Kiri Te Kanawa, and Gary Carr.

"Downton Abbey has seen many great characters visit the house over the years and we couldn't be more thrilled to welcome the new faces that will be joining the regular cast of Downton Abbey in Season 4," said executive producer Gareth Neame. "We hope audiences will be as excited about them as we are."
